Quick Checks You Can Do Safely
It’s natural to want a quick fix when the house is chilly. Start with safe, low-effort checks that cover the most common culprits. You’ll often identify the issue without tools.
- Check the power: Look at the furnace outlet, wall switch, and any reset buttons. If a breaker has tripped, reset it and test the system.
- Verify thermostat settings: Ensure the thermostat is set to heat, not cool, and that the temperature is above the current room temperature. If you rely on a programmable model, confirm the schedule hasn’t overridden the setting.
- Inspect airflow: Vacuum or replace dirty air filters, and ensure vents aren’t blocked by furniture or drapes. Restricted airflow can trigger safety shutoffs and reduce heating performance.
- Listen for signals: A furnace or heat pump that’s stubborn to start may emit clicking sounds or a humming motor. While some noises are normal, unusual sounds can indicate a motor, blower, or relay issue that requires a pro.
- Look for error codes: If your furnace display shows codes, consult the manual or Heater Cost resources to decode them. Codes guide you toward the likely cause without guesswork.
If you’re uneasy about any step or you notice signs of danger, stop and call a professional. The aim is to narrow the fault safely and accurately, rather than guessing and risking damage or injury.
Gas vs Electric: Common Causes and Quick Fixes
Different heater types show different patterns when they fail. Electric heaters typically error out on circuit or thermostat issues, while gas furnaces might trip safety switches or lose ignition. Here’s how to approach each:
- Electric heaters: Check power supply, outlet integrity, and internal thermostat. A faulty element or blown fuse may require replacement by a technician.
- Gas furnaces: Verify the gas supply, ensure the valve is open, and check the pilot light or electronic ignition. Gas systems involve combustion safety and should be handled by pros if ignition fails or you detect gas odor.
For both types, if the unit attempted to start but didn’t reach full heat, you should consider airflow and venting, furnace filter condition, and potential thermostat communication issues with the control board. These factors are common, solvable with proper steps, and often inexpensive to fix compared to full replacement.
Safety First: When to Call a Professional
Certain scenarios demand professional evaluation immediately. If you smell gas or hear a hissing leak, evacuate and contact your gas provider or emergency services. Any suspected electrical fault should be treated with caution—shut off power at the main panel if safe to do so and call a licensed electrician or HVAC technician. Routine maintenance and diagnostics that involve gas piping, refrigerant, or electrical wiring should always be performed by trained technicians to avoid hazards.
Before a professional visit, gather basic information: model and serial number, symptoms, when the issue started, and any error codes. This helps the technician diagnose quickly and accurately, reducing downtime and cost.
Step-by-Step Troubleshooting Guide
This section provides a practical workflow to identify and address the most common issues behind a non-working heater. It’s designed to be followed in order, from easiest to more involved checks. If you encounter safety concerns or the steps don’t resolve the problem, stop and contact a pro.
- Confirm power and reset: Reset breakers, replace fuses if accessible, and cycle the power to the unit.
- Check thermostat: Replace batteries if applicable, recalibrate, and ensure wiring is connected and communicating with the furnace.
- Inspect air flow: Clean or replace air filters; ensure intake and exhaust paths are clear.
- Inspect safety interlocks: Ensure internal switches are engaged properly and that the blower is not blocked.
- Review gas components (if applicable): Verify valve position and ignition sequence; do not attempt to relight if you’re uncertain.
- Test after each step: If heat returns, you have identified the issue; if not, continue to the next step or call a professional.
Tip: Keep a simple log of which steps worked as you go. This helps the technician reproduce and fix the problem faster.
